[Role of Th9, Th17, Treg Cells levels and IL-9, IL-17 and TGF-β Expression in Peripheral Blood of Patients with ITP in Pathogenesis of ITP].

Abstract

OBJECTIVE

To detect the levels of Treg, Th17, Th9 cells and expression of transforming growth factor-β (TGF-β), interleukin-17 (IL-17) and interleukin-9 (IL-9) in peripheral blood of patients with immune thrombocytopenia (ITP) and to explore its role in the pathogenesis of ITP.

METHODS

Fifty-four patients with ITP (ITP group) and 40 healthy volunteers (control group) were selected in our hospital. The of Treg, Th17 and Th9 cells in peripheral blood of 2 groups were measured by flow cytometry, and the expression of cytokines, such as TGF-β, IL-17 and IL-9 in the peripheral blood of 2 groups were detected by enzyme linked immunosorbent assay (ELISA).

RESULTS

The level of Treg cells in the peripheral blood of the ITP group was significantly decreased in comparison with the control group, while the levels of Th17 and Th9 cells significantly increased in comparison with the control group (all P<0.01). The expression of cytokine such as TGF-β in the peripheral blood of the case group significantly decreased in comparison with the control group, while the expression levels of IL-17 and IL-9 significantly increased in comparison with the control group (P<0.01). The results of Pearson correlation analysis showed that there was a positive correlation between the level of Treg cells and platelet count (PLT) in peripheral blood of the ITP group (r=0.35, P<0.05), and there were negative correlation between the level rate of Th17, Th9 cells and Plt count (r=-0.37, -0.43, P<0.05); there was a positive correlation between the expression of the TGF-β in the ITP group and Plt count (r=0.46, P<0.05), while the expression of IL-17 and IL-9 showed negative correlation with PLT (r=-0.48, -0.54, P<0.05).

CONCLUSION

The percentage of Treg, Th17 and Th9 cells in the peripheral blood of patients with ITP is abnormal, and the expression of TGF-β, IL-17 and IL-9 also is abnormal, which may play an important role in the pathogenesis of ITP.

摘要

目的

检测免疫性血小板减少症(ITP)患者外周血中调节性T细胞(Treg)、辅助性T细胞17(Th17)、辅助性T细胞9(Th9)水平及转化生长因子-β(TGF-β)、白细胞介素-17(IL-17)和白细胞介素-9(IL-9)的表达,探讨其在ITP发病机制中的作用。

方法

选取我院54例ITP患者(ITP组)和40例健康志愿者(对照组)。采用流式细胞术检测两组外周血中Treg、Th17和Th9细胞水平,采用酶联免疫吸附测定(ELISA)法检测两组外周血中TGF-β、IL-17和IL-9等细胞因子的表达。

结果

ITP组外周血中Treg细胞水平较对照组显著降低,而Th17和Th9细胞水平较对照组显著升高(均P<0.01)。病例组外周血中TGF-β等细胞因子表达较对照组显著降低,而IL-17和IL-9表达水平较对照组显著升高(P<0.01)。Pearson相关性分析结果显示,ITP组外周血中Treg细胞水平与血小板计数(PLT)呈正相关(r=0.35,P<0.05),Th17、Th9细胞水平与Plt计数呈负相关(r=-0.37,-0.43,P<0.05);ITP组中TGF-β表达与Plt计数呈正相关(r=0.46,P<0.05),而IL-17和IL-9表达与PLT呈负相关(r=-0.48,-0.54,P<0.05)。

结论

ITP患者外周血中Treg、Th17和Th9细胞百分比异常,TGF-β、IL-17和IL-9表达也异常,这可能在ITP发病机制中起重要作用。
